“The archives and echoes of the urban city hold a significant conversation around my paintings, which focus on the ethical values of social criticism, political statement and the scars of the urban world and its inhabitants… in many ways an academic approach to painting. Over the last year, archives have alternated their position within me.

The state of observing and embodying the urban has become less prevalent in my paintings somehow –– there has become more of a shift towards the archive of me embodying and divining the mood of nature and spirit of things.

To me, it's radiated my paintings into a state where it's an attempt to interpret and understand who we are, and how we find each other in our bodies, in each other and the countries and places inhabited. I'd like to think about it as a state where the unconscious can run free, and painting somehow returns to its origins, a place filled with language and a mystery that can only be expressed in abstracted symbols and lyrical images”

About

Sebastian Lloyd Rees (b. 1986, Stavanger, Norway) is an artist based between Athens and London. With the artist Ali Eisa, he is part of an ongoing collaboration known as Lloyd Corporation.

Since completing his BA at Goldsmiths in 2010, Lloyd Rees’s painting has evolved through several distinct stages; all of which interrogate the ways in which painting can articulate the subjective interactions between the artist and the ever-changing built and natural environments that he has called home.

In his first major series, the Hoarding Works (2014–2018), Lloyd Rees worked with repurposed wooden boards that had been recovered from the hoarding around construction sites in London and New York. In 2020, after moving to Athens, Lloyd Rees developed a more lyrical visual language to reflect his emerging relationship with the Mediterranean, culminating in the Black Paintings (2021–2023) – the subject of a solo exhibition at Vardaxoglou in the Autumn of 2023.

Lloyd Rees continues to chart this relationship with the Stonehouse series (2024–), which includes both paintings and works on paper and takes significant inspiration from the poetry of Shiwu, or Stonehouse, a 13th-century hermit who lived in the mountains of Yushan, China.
